Are you an Earthworks Examiner with experience working on Network Rail projects?
Do you have Level 3 Competency in Network Rail's Soil Slope Examinations and Rock Slope Examinations?
This is an excellent opportunity for an Earthworks Examiner to join Network Rail to work on earthworks examinations across the NW&C region.
Rate: £427/day - Umbrella, Inside IR35
Location: Office Based - Manchester or Liverpool or Warrington - 1 day/ week remote
Duration: 6 months, potential for extension
Requirements:
·Previously assessed as Level 3 Competency in Network Rail's 'Soil Slope Examinations' (GEO-I-S) and Rock 'Slope Examinations' (GEO-I-R).
·Experience in use of JBA Database and GizMapp tool.
·Experience in producing high quality exams to CIV/065 standard
·Knowledge of relevant railway geography and network capability.
·Knowledge of railway 'Safe Systems of Work', i.e. Separated Working, Possessions, Line Blocks, Blockades, etc.)
·PTS, COSS, IWA
Responsibilities:
·Support the Geotechnical Examination Team to deliver activities associated with planning
·Complete Earthwork Examinations.
·Carry out 'on-site' work safely and efficiently in accordance with safe systems of work procedures, method statements, standards or other relevant instructions.
·Accurately report all work completed/not completed and produce/maintain records as required
·Adhere to company policies and procedures.
·'Desk Based' site reconnaissance studies to understand most suitable access strategy to undertake Earthwork Examinations.
·Liaising with Access Planning teams in order to finalise plans, logistics and Safe Work Packs.
·Completion of Examinations in line with NR_L3_CIV_065.
·Closeout of any rejected exams and to respond to feedback
